Charles Everett Faulkner – St George News

Sept 2, 1951 — Aug 14, 2022

Charles “Chuck” Everett Faulkner, 70, passed away on Aug. 14, 2022, in St. George, Utah. Chuck was born in Maywood, Ca., on Sept. 2, 1951. He is survived by his wife, Mary; his mother, Lillian; brothers: Craig and Guy; children: Brent (Kelly), Davin (Allison), Chad (Crystal), Adam (Milissa), and Susie (Brandon) Chatham; grandchildren: Khloe, Kaitlyn, Preston, Leah, Bailey, Jared, Nathan, Cooper, Jaxon, Mason, Reese, Johnny, Chelsie, Addie, Kadie, & Hudson. He was preceded in death by his father, Everett Faulkner.

Chuck was raised in Downey, Calif., and graduated from Downey High School in 1969. Chuck and Mary were married in the Los Angeles Temple on Aug. 4, 1973. They moved to Riverside in 1977, where they raised their five children and had the blessings of many friends. He was a structural designer and graduated with a bachelor’s degree from the University of Phoenix. Chuck was an active member of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ints, an avid car enthusiast, and had many, many other quirky interests. He and Mary moved to St George in October of 2020.
